While working on a rhythm track, Waters liked what they had done however Gilmour wanted to change it and re-cut the drum from the track. This collaboration for ‘Comfortably Numb’ led to a great controversy between Gilmour and Waters. Instead, ‘Comfortably Numb’ became a track of Pink Floyd’s eleventh album, ‘The Wall.’ That’s why it wasn’t released on his solo album. ‘Comfortably Numb’ was first created and performed by David Gilmour in recording sessions for his debut solo studio album entitled ‘David Gilmour.’ The song was a wordless demo in the beginning and Roger Waters decided to write the lyrics of the song. ![]() Eventually, one of the greatest songs of the band was created and left a great story behind it. It caused great fights and controversies between Pink Floyd co-founder and bassist, Roger Waters and another co-founder and guitarist and co-lead vocalist, David Gilmour. The creation of ‘Comfortably Numb’ was a very challenging process for Pink Floyd.
